Experience with parallel programming models using bulk-synchronous and asynchronous (e.g., MPI, threading) parallelism and modern heterogeneous computing architectures (e.g., GPUs) * Experience with ...
Experience with parallel programming models using bulk-synchronous and asynchronous (e.g., MPI, threading) parallelism and modern heterogeneous computing architectures (e.g., GPUs) * Experience with ...
Experience with parallel programming models using bulk-synchronous and asynchronous (e.g., MPI, threading) parallelism and modern heterogeneous computing architectures (e.g., GPUs) * Experience with ...
Experience with parallel programming models using bulk-synchronous and asynchronous (e.g., MPI, threading) parallelism and modern heterogeneous computing architectures (e.g., GPUs) * Experience with ...
High Performance Computing Software Engineer (Scientist 2)
Los Alamos, NM · On-site
$152K/yr
Responsibilities : • Develop and optimize cutting-edge algorithms for massively parallel multi ... programming techniques. • C++ standards knowledge. • Experience with LANL's mission and ...
High Performance Computing Software Engineer (Scientist 2)
Los Alamos, NM · On-site
$152K/yr
Responsibilities : • Develop and optimize cutting-edge algorithms for massively parallel multi ... programming techniques. • C++ standards knowledge. • Experience with LANL's mission and ...
High Performance Computing Software Engineer (Scientist 3)
Los Alamos, NM · On-site
$152K/yr
Responsibilities : • Develop and optimize cutting-edge algorithms for massively parallel multi ... programming) and C++ standards knowledge strongly preferred. • Experience working within LANL ...
High Performance Computing Software Engineer (Scientist 3)
Los Alamos, NM · On-site
$152K/yr
Responsibilities : • Develop and optimize cutting-edge algorithms for massively parallel multi ... programming) and C++ standards knowledge strongly preferred. • Experience working within LANL ...
Come join Wood as a Mechanical Engineer in Carlsbad, NM. Wood offers health benefits, 401k ... Project Execution - Self-motivated lead responsible for multiple parallel projects with minimal to ...
Come join Wood as a Mechanical Engineer in Carlsbad, NM. Wood offers health benefits, 401k ... Project Execution - Self-motivated lead responsible for multiple parallel projects with minimal to ...
Exposure to parallel computing or large-scale simulations is a plus Communication and Teamwork ... complex models * modern programming languages (e.g., Python, Matlab, C++) * modern software ...
Exposure to parallel computing or large-scale simulations is a plus Communication and Teamwork ... complex models * modern programming languages (e.g., Python, Matlab, C++) * modern software ...
Exposure to parallel computing or large-scale simulations is a plus Communication and Teamwork ... complex models * modern programming languages (e.g., Python, Matlab, C++) * modern software ...
Exposure to parallel computing or large-scale simulations is a plus Communication and Teamwork ... complex models * modern programming languages (e.g., Python, Matlab, C++) * modern software ...
Early Career R&D Mechanical Engineer - Computational Solid Mechanics, Onsite
Albuquerque, NM · On-site
$102K - $199K/yr
... parallel computers. The department has expertise in complex material response, large deformation ... Graduate degree in Mechanical Engineering or a highly related field where an independent research ...
Early Career R&D Mechanical Engineer - Computational Solid Mechanics, Onsite
Albuquerque, NM · On-site
$102K - $199K/yr
... parallel computers. The department has expertise in complex material response, large deformation ... Graduate degree in Mechanical Engineering or a highly related field where an independent research ...
Responsibilities : • Develop, implement, and exercise high explosives models in massively parallel multi-physics codes. • Research and development of applied physics and engineering models. • ...
Responsibilities : • Develop, implement, and exercise high explosives models in massively parallel multi-physics codes. • Research and development of applied physics and engineering models. • ...
High Performance Computing Software Engineer (Scientist 3)
Los Alamos, NM · On-site
$127K/yr
High Performance Computing Proven expertise in developing and implementing massively parallel ... programming) and C++ standards knowledge strongly preferred. Mission Focus Experience working ...
High Performance Computing Software Engineer (Scientist 3)
Los Alamos, NM · On-site
$127K/yr
High Performance Computing Proven expertise in developing and implementing massively parallel ... programming) and C++ standards knowledge strongly preferred. Mission Focus Experience working ...
High Performance Computing Proven expertise in developing and implementing massively parallel ... programming) and C++ standards knowledge strongly preferred. Mission Focus Experience working ...
High Performance Computing Proven expertise in developing and implementing massively parallel ... programming) and C++ standards knowledge strongly preferred. Mission Focus Experience working ...
High Performance Computing Software Engineer (Scientist 1)
Los Alamos, NM · On-site
$127K/yr
High Performance Computing Candidate will require demonstrated experience with massively parallel ... programming techniques along with C++ standards knowledge will be given preference. Mission Focus ...
High Performance Computing Software Engineer (Scientist 1)
Los Alamos, NM · On-site
$127K/yr
High Performance Computing Candidate will require demonstrated experience with massively parallel ... programming techniques along with C++ standards knowledge will be given preference. Mission Focus ...
High Performance Computing Software Engineer (Scientist 1)
Los Alamos, NM · On-site
$127K/yr
High Performance Computing Candidate will require demonstrated experience with massively parallel ... programming techniques along with C++ standards knowledge will be given preference. Mission Focus ...
High Performance Computing Software Engineer (Scientist 1)
Los Alamos, NM · On-site
$127K/yr
High Performance Computing Candidate will require demonstrated experience with massively parallel ... programming techniques along with C++ standards knowledge will be given preference. Mission Focus ...
High Performance Computing Software Engineer (Scientist 2)
Los Alamos, NM · On-site
$127K/yr
High Performance Computing Demonstrated experience with massively parallel numerical development ... programming techniques along with C++ standards knowledge will be given preference. Mission Focus ...
High Performance Computing Software Engineer (Scientist 2)
Los Alamos, NM · On-site
$127K/yr
High Performance Computing Demonstrated experience with massively parallel numerical development ... programming techniques along with C++ standards knowledge will be given preference. Mission Focus ...
High Performance Computing Candidate will require demonstrated experience with massively parallel ... programming techniques along with C++ standards knowledge will be given preference. Mission Focus ...
High Performance Computing Candidate will require demonstrated experience with massively parallel ... programming techniques along with C++ standards knowledge will be given preference. Mission Focus ...
High Performance Computing Proven expertise in developing and implementing massively parallel ... programming) and C++ standards knowledge strongly preferred. Mission Focus Experience working ...
High Performance Computing Proven expertise in developing and implementing massively parallel ... programming) and C++ standards knowledge strongly preferred. Mission Focus Experience working ...
HPC Systems Splst 2
Albuquerque, NM · On-site
Provides intermediate level systems programming and management functions for large scale, high ... Good working knowledge of high-performance computing systems; scalable, parallel architectures; and ...
HPC Systems Splst 2
Albuquerque, NM · On-site
Provides intermediate level systems programming and management functions for large scale, high ... Good working knowledge of high-performance computing systems; scalable, parallel architectures; and ...
High Performance Computing Software Engineer (Scientist 2)
Los Alamos, NM · On-site
$127K/yr
High Performance Computing Demonstrated experience with massively parallel numerical development ... programming techniques along with C++ standards knowledge will be given preference. Mission Focus ...
High Performance Computing Software Engineer (Scientist 2)
Los Alamos, NM · On-site
$127K/yr
High Performance Computing Demonstrated experience with massively parallel numerical development ... programming techniques along with C++ standards knowledge will be given preference. Mission Focus ...
Provides intermediate level systems programming and management functions for large scale, high ... Good working knowledge of high-performance computing systems; scalable, parallel architectures; and ...
Provides intermediate level systems programming and management functions for large scale, high ... Good working knowledge of high-performance computing systems; scalable, parallel architectures; and ...
HPC Systems Splst 1
Albuquerque, NM · On-site
Provides entry-level systems programming and systems management support in high-performance ... Knowledge of high performance computing systems; scalable, parallel architectures; and basic ...
HPC Systems Splst 1
Albuquerque, NM · On-site
Provides entry-level systems programming and systems management support in high-performance ... Knowledge of high performance computing systems; scalable, parallel architectures; and basic ...
Parallel Programming information
See New Mexico salary details
$78.5K - $82.8K
3% of jobs
$82.8K - $87.1K
5% of jobs
$87.1K - $91.4K
5% of jobs
$91.4K - $95.8K
5% of jobs
$98.7K is the 25th percentile. Wages below this are outliers.
$95.8K - $100.1K
9% of jobs
$100.1K - $104.4K
7% of jobs
$104.4K - $108.7K
13% of jobs
The median wage is $109.2K / yr.
$108.7K - $113K
18% of jobs
$115.2K is the 75th percentile. Wages above this are outliers.
$113K - $117.3K
18% of jobs
$117.3K - $121.7K
11% of jobs
$121.7K - $126K
5% of jobs
$78.5K
$107.3K
$126K
How much do parallel programming jobs pay per year?
What is a Parallel Programming job?
A Parallel Programming job involves developing software that can execute multiple tasks or computations simultaneously to improve performance and efficiency. Professionals in this field work with multi-core processors, distributed systems, and GPU computing to optimize software for speed and scalability. They typically use programming models like MPI, OpenMP, or CUDA to implement parallelism. Industries such as high-performance computing, data science, and machine learning heavily rely on parallel programming to handle large-scale computations.
What are some typical challenges encountered in a Parallel Programming role?
Professionals in parallel programming often face challenges such as identifying code sections that can be effectively parallelized, managing data dependencies, and handling synchronization between parallel tasks. Debugging and optimizing performance in multi-threaded or distributed environments can also be complex, requiring patience and attention to detail. Collaboration with data scientists, hardware engineers, and other software developers is common, as projects frequently involve cross-functional teamwork. Overcoming these challenges is a rewarding part of the job, leading to faster, more efficient software solutions that can have a significant impact in fields like scientific computing, finance, and machine learning.
What are the key skills and qualifications needed to thrive in the Parallel Programming position, and why are they important?
To excel in Parallel Programming, you need a solid background in computer science, strong proficiency in languages such as C/C++, Python, or Java, and experience with parallel computing frameworks. Familiarity with tools like OpenMP, MPI, CUDA, or parallel processing libraries, as well as relevant certifications or coursework, is highly valuable. Analytical thinking, collaboration, and effective problem-solving are essential soft skills for success in this role. These competencies enable professionals to efficiently develop, debug, and optimize scalable applications in high-performance computing environments.

Radiation Transport Postdoctoral Research Associate
Los Alamos National LaboratoryLos Alamos, NM • On-site
Full-time
Medical, Dental, Vision, Life, Retirement, PTO
Posted 21 days ago
Los Alamos National Laboratory rating
9.2
Based on 32 frontline employees who took The Breakroom Quiz
7th of 103 rated laboratories
Job description
Job Title Radiation Transport Postdoctoral Research Associate
Location Los Alamos, NM, US
Organization Name CAI-2 / Computational Physics and Methods Group
Minimum Salary
Maximum Salary
What You Will D o
The Radiation Transport Team within the Computational Physics and Methods group (CAI-2) is seeking an outstanding candidate for a postdoctoral position developing computational transport methods and software. In collaboration with their future mentor, they will propose a well-defined research plan that will allow them to develop new skills and knowledge and produce computational methods and results that can be published in the scientific literature and presented at technical conferences.
CAI-2 is a dynamic, collaborative group engaged in the entire computational-physics workflow, from developing novel methods to delivering production-grade single- and multi-physics codes. We engage in fundamental and applied research across diverse fields, including r adiation transport, fluid dynamics and turbulent flows, metal casting and advanced manufacturing, Earth systems, astrophysics and plasma physics . The Radiation Transport Team provides subject matter expertise and production software products in the areas of linear and nonlinear neutral particle transport (neutron/gamma, thermal X-rays), charged particle transport, and high energy-density physics.
What You Need
Minimum Job Requirements:
Technical Expertise
Expertise in one or more of the following areas
- Theoretical and numerical methods for radiation transport
- Software development for radiation transport
- Applications of transport methods and codes
- Computational algorithm development
Communication
Effective interpersonal skills, as well as excellent oral and written communications skills. Demonstrated ability to publish in the relevant academic journals.
Problem Solving
Demonstrated ability to analyze and provide creative solutions for technically complex problems.
Computing
Excellent scientific programming skills and experience with languages such as Python, C/C++, and/or Fortran for scientific applications. Ability to work and communicate effectively in a collaborative software development environment.
Clearance
Eligible to apply for a DOE Q clearance.
Education/Experience : Ph.D. in nuclear engineering, physics, or a related field soon to be completed or completed within the last five years.
Desired Qualifications:
- Experience with parallel programming models using bulk-synchronous and asynchronous (e.g., MPI, threading) parallelism and modern heterogeneous computing architectures (e.g., GPUs)
- Experience with modern task - based parallel programming models
- Experience with modern software development techniques, i.e., compilers, computer hardware design, portability, continuous integration, unit testing, and regression testing
- Experience in other related science and application areas beyond those mentioned above , e.g., turbulence, plasma physics, thermal hydraulics, radiation health physics, radiation detection, radiation-hydrodynamics, multiphase flow, materials science
- Active DOE Q clearance
W ork Location : The work location for this position is onsite and located in Los Alamos, NM. All work locations are at the discretion of management.
Note to Applicants:
Due to federal restrictions contained in the current National Defense Authorization Act, citizens of the People's Republic of China-including the special administrative regions of Hong Kong and Macau-as well as citizens of the Islamic Republic of Iran, the Democratic People's Republic of Korea (North Korea), and the Russian Federation, who are not Lawful Permanent Residents ("green card" holders) are prohibited from accessing facilities that support the mission, functions, and operations of national security laboratories and nuclear weapons production facilities, which includes Los Alamos National Laboratory.
For full consideration, please submit a CV, detailed cover letter describing how you satisfy the job requirements and contact information for three professional references familiar with your work.
Contact Erin Davis ( ejdavis@lanl.gov ) and/or Joe Zerr ( rzerr@lanl.gov ) for more details about this position.
Where You Will Work
Located in beautiful northern New Mexico, Los Alamos National Laboratory (LANL) is a multidisciplinary research institution engaged in strategic science on behalf of national security. Our generous benefits package includes:
§ PPO or High Deductible medical insurance with the same large nationwide network
§ Dental and vision insurance
§ Free basic life and disability insurance
§ Paid childbirth and parental leave
§ Award-winning 401(k) (6% matching plus 3.5% annually)
§ Learning opportunities and tuition assistance
§ Flexible schedules and time off (PTO and holidays)
§ Onsite gyms and wellness programs
§ Extensive relocation packages (outside a 50 mile radius)
Additional Details
Directive 206.2 - Employment with Triad requires a favorable decision by NNSA indicating employee is suitable under NNSA Supplemental Directive 206.2 . Please note that this requirement applies only to citizens of the United States. Foreign nationals are subject to a similar requirement under DOE Order 142.3A.
Clearance: Q (Position will be cleared to this level). Selected applicants will be subject to a background investigation conducted by or on behalf of the Federal Government, and must meet eligibility requirements* for access to classified matter. This position requires a Q clearance, and obtaining such clearance requires US Citizenship except in extremely rare circumstances. Dependent upon the position, additional authorization to access classified information may be required, which may or may not be available to dual citizens. Receipt of a Q clearance and additional access authorization ultimately is a decision of the Federal Government and not of Triad.
*Eligibility requirements: To obtain a clearance, an individual must be at least 18 years of age; U.S. citizenship is required except in very limited circumstances. See DOE Order 472.2 for additional information.
New-Employment Drug Test: The Laboratory requires successful applicants to complete a new-employment drug test and maintains a substance abuse policy that includes random drug testing. Although New Mexico and other states have legalized the use of marijuana, use and possession of marijuana remain illegal under federal law. A positive drug test for marijuana will result in termination of employment, even if the use was pre-offer.
Internal Applicants: Regular appointment employees who have served the required period of continuous service in their current position are eligible to apply for posted jobs throughout the Laboratory. If an employee has not served the required period of continuous service, they may only apply for Laboratory jobs with the documented approval of their Division Leader. Please refer to Policy Policy P701 for applicant eligibility requirements.
Equal Opportunity: Los Alamos National Laboratory is an equal opportunity employer. All employment practices are based on qualification and merit, without regard to protected categories such as race, color, national origin, ancestry, religion, age, sex, gender identity, sexual orientation, marital status or spousal affiliation, physical or mental disability, medical conditions, pregnancy, status as a protected veteran, genetic information, or citizenship within the limits imposed by federal, state, and local laws and regulations. The Laboratory is also committed to making our workplace accessible to individuals with disabilities and will provide reasonable accommodations, upon request, for individuals to participate in the application and hiring process. To request such an accommodation, please send an email to applyhelp@lanl.gov or call (505)-664-6947.
Instructions on How to Activate/Create a LANL Jobs Account:
Follow the instructions below if you have ever had an employee Z number, been a contractor, or received Los Alamos Lab insurance coverage to activate your account:
- Select the Click Here button if you have been employed with the Lab or received insurance coverage .
- Please enter only your first and last name and current email address (an email with your validation code will be sent to you) to activate the account currently in our system.
- Enter your validation code as described in the email you receive and complete the 3-page registration form. Your account is now active, and you can apply for jobs or save to your basket. Important : Enter the validation code within 15 days to activate your account or your account will be deactivated.
Follow the instructions below if you if you have never been employed with the Lab or received insurance coverage to create an account:
- Select the Register button if you have never been employed with the Lab or received insurance coverage to Create an Account.
- From here, you will establish an account with username and password.
How to Apply: Login to Your Account to Complete the Application Process
- Click the Vacancy Name number (in blue) to view any job's details.
- Click Apply or Add to Basket to apply later. Tip : To apply for a job or save your basket, you must have a LANL jobs account.
If you experience any technical issues, please email applyhelp@lanl.gov for assistance.
Employment Status Full Time
Appointment Type Postdoc
Postdoc
What Los Alamos National Laboratory employees say
Pay
Benefits
Hours and flexibility
Workplace
Get the full story on Breakroom
About Los Alamos National Laboratory
Sourced by ZipRecruiter
Industry
Scientific research and development services
Company size
5,001 - 10,000 Employees
Headquarters location
Los Alamos, NM, US
Year founded
1943